> > is the file 'authorizenet' in your /usr/local/interchange/globalsub/
> directory?
> >
> > if not, copy it from the interchange src dist in
> > ../src/interchange/eg/globalsub/
> >
> > might be the problem.

> > > I am adding the Authorize.net commands into the cfg files.  When I
> restart
> > > the server, I get an error from catalog.cfg that gives a syntax error
> for
> > > the authorize.net ID.
> > > What I added is:
> > >
> > > # Username and password
> > >  Variable MV_PAYMENT_ID      (my 7 digit numeric ID)
> > >  Variable MV_PAYMENT_SECRET  MyPassword
> > >  Variable MV_PAYMENT_MODE    custom authorizenet
> > >  Variable MV_PAYMENT_REFERER my authorize.net referrer url.
> > >
> > > Why does the variable not recognize the numeric id?
